On April 22, 2025, Fidelity's trading volume was 4.28 billion, a significant decrease of 46.65% compared to the previous day, ranking 196th in the day's stock market activity.
Fidelity National Information Services, Inc. (FIS) has been on a steady upward trajectory, experiencing a notable increase in its stock price over the past three days. This positive momentum has been driven by several factors, including strong financial performance and strategic initiatives that have bolstered investor confidence.
